Transaction 12998c574cb024e6134438b31158b004c136c435042753b73c16ac9824694484

1 Input
2 Outputs
  • 12998c574cb024e6134438b31158b004c136c435042753b73c16ac9824694484:0
  • value  795913
    address  3KP31UEfvdQ1J1UXp2fyCFsPZExDJbqSZ9
  • 12998c574cb024e6134438b31158b004c136c435042753b73c16ac9824694484:1
  • value  11907826
    address  3CdENJombZn3FZD2Kv2mic5BD7cksv3AWM